Warning Signs You Need Insulation Water Damage Restoration
Don’t ignore the warning signs of water damage. Catching these issues early can save you thousands of dollars and prevent more extensive damage down the line.
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
Strong, unpleasant odors can be a sign of mold growth or water damage. If you notice persistent musty smells in your attic or walls, it’s time to call in the experts.
Warped or Discolored Insulation
Water damage can cause insulation to become discolored, warped, or soggy. If you notice any of these signs, it’s essential to address the issue quickly.
Water Stains on Ceilings or Walls
Water stains can be a sign of a larger problem. If you notice water spots or discoloration on your ceilings or walls, don’t ignore them.
Unusual Sounds or Creaks
Unusual sounds or creaks in your attic or walls can show water damage or structural issues. Don’t dismiss these signs, they could be a warning sign of a more significant problem.
Increased Energy Bills
Water damage can compromise your insulation’s effectiveness, leading to increased energy bills. If you notice a sudden spike in your energy costs, it’s time to investigate.
Visible Signs of Puddling or Water Leaks
Visible signs of puddling or water leaks are a clear indication of water damage. Don’t wait, address the issue quickly to prevent further damage.

Insulation Water Damage Restoration Cost in Middle River, MD
The cost of insulation water damage restoration can vary depending on the severity of the damage, size of the affected area, and local conditions. Our estimates are based on a thorough assessment of your property and a customized plan to address your specific needs.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water removal and drying | $500 – $2,500 | Size of affected area, severity of damage, and equipment needed |
| Insulation inspection and replacement | $1,000 – $5,000 | Type and quality of insulation materials, size of affected area |
| Dehumidification and monitoring | $500 – $2,000 | Duration of dehumidification, equipment needed, and monitoring requirements |
| Final inspection and clean-up | $200 – $1,000 | Size of affected area, complexity of restoration |
